Switzerland

The world's youngest Cheese Master, Afrim Pristine, sets out on an adventure to learn even more about his true love: cheese. His journey starts in Switzerland. Though best known for its rich, tasty chocolates, high-end watches, and infamous banking system, Switzerland is a global capital for cheese. 

Heading to the Alps is the perfect place to start gaining an understanding of Swiss cuisine and its rich history with cheese. Afrim meets with chefs, cheese makers, vendors and even a legendary affineur (to learn the fine art of aging) and to take in a new wealth of knowledge and experience unlike he's anything he's ever seen. 

In the motherland of Gruyere, Raclette, Fondue, and of course the famous holey Swiss Emmental, Afrim learns firsthand how these classics stand the test of time and what new and modern takes the Swiss have to share with the world.
